Abstract:A new retaining method for deep excavation-prestressed anchor flexible retaining method has been developed by the authors. This technique is studied by finite difference method;and the calculating results are compared with the soil-nailed support system. Critical slide zone of deep excavation is controlled by prestress values. Based on the modified bar system finite element method,the prestressed anchor flexible retaining system is calculated and analyzed through a practical engineering. The distribution rules of horizontal displacements and anchor axial force are calculated. By the numerical analysis,its advantages such as small displacements and application to super-deep excavations are investigated.
